Overview
An adventure, casual, indie game by YAD Project, published by YAD Project — single-player, multi-player, co-op, online co-op.
Steam’s own one-line description: “Embark on an exciting journey with your friends or on your own! To reach the top, you'll have to solve challenging puzzles, overcome dangerous obstacles, and coordinate with each other. Laser communication is both a blessing and a challenge!” — developer/publisher text via the Steam store page.

System requirements (PC)
As published on the Steam store page. Requirements can change between updates.
Minimum
- Requires a 64-bit processor and operating system
- OS: Windows 10/11
- Processor: Intel Core i5-9400F 2.9 GHz
- Memory: 4 GB RAM
- Graphics: GeForce GTX 1050 4GB
- DirectX: Version 10
- Network: Broadband Internet connection
- Storage: 4 GB available space
